## Bulk Edits: Limits & Quotas

Quick heads-up for release: the Copperstack admin table now caps bulk edits so nobody can update 50k rows in one click and lock the writer pool again (looking at you, last Tuesday). Edits over the cap get chunked automatically, with a short pause between chunks. These caps ship enabled by default in the next cut. The chunking constants are as follows.

tuning table, kajog-kawef:
PRIORITIES = {
    "kelox": 870,
    "kasix": 89,
    "eliax": 988,
}

Handover: Eventspine schema registry

Hey, passing this to you before I'm off to the Karvel office next week. Plugin authors keep asking how the registry validates payloads — short answer: strict mode, no auto-evolution, subjects are per-event-type. Docs are half-done, sorry. Everything they need to point their plugins at is in the config below.

deployment values, bahof-badug:
[rusix]
team = zorok
access_code = ac_641cbe
owner = ulair.tamius
host = rusix.torvasoft.local
port = 5672
peer = ulaix.sivrelworks.internal
salt = 1df570ed
pin = 6327

Handover — spare hardware store, Basement 2, Ferncroft Tower. Shelving relabelled last week; monitors left wall, docks and cables centre, laptops in the locked cage. Cage key lives in the facilities drawer. Log everything out in the blue binder — no exceptions, audits are monthly. Door self-locks; don't wedge it, the alarm triggers after four minutes. Pending: two broken chairs awaiting collection Thursday. You'll need the store's keypad code, which follows below.

badge for fafop-fajof: bdg-Z-47

# Tracing configuration for the Moorvane service mesh.
# Request tracing spans all microservices via the Quillport collector;
# every service must propagate the trace header or spans will orphan.
# Sampling rate is set below (TRACE_SAMPLE_RATE, default 0.05); raise it
# only during incident investigation, as storage costs scale linearly.
# Do not disable tracing in shared environments without notifying the
# platform rotation. The collector rejects unauthenticated exporters,
# so its access secret must be set on the very next line.

secret setting of tajog-bafog: RELAY_SECRET13=8f6af7680fb2b